liam-changeset-ci-trigger
released this
18 Dec 06:20
·
49 commits
to main
since this release
π New Features
1. A brand-new loading screen is here! π
Take a short breather while Liam gets ready for you!
2. Improved ERD Main View! πβ¨
Weβve adjusted the TableDetail width to make the Main View much easier on the eyes.
π Bug Fixes
- Fixed the direction of cardinality. π
- Tables now stay in focus when opened via query parameters. π§
- You can copy links even when Table Detail is open. π
- Resolved an issue where column types would disappear. π
π§Ή Refactoring & Optimizations
- Hidden nodes now also hide their cardinality! π΅οΈββοΈ
- Refactored for better performance:
- Reduced calculations for table column displays. β‘
- Selecting a table now highlights its relations and cardinality too! π―
All Changes
- 987082d: Update hidden node cardinalities
- 60bfdeb: refactor: Move the calculation to TableColumnList and TableColumn only displays the props
- 16118e3: π add loading spinner
- 9c44a6a: fix: Fixed an issue where the correct table was not focused when sharing URLs in TableDetail
- 3ebbac2: Corrected incorrect cardinality direction.
- c3756b1: Reduce the width of TableDetail to prevent TableNode from being obscured
- 594a73b: Enable hiding cardinalities on source node if target node is hidden
- 88cf707: refactor: The behavior of TableNode when clicked is unified to be handled by ERDContent
- b08232b: Highlight related edges and cardinalities when a TableNode is active.
- e21fdc5: Enable clicking while Table Detail opened
- 296fdaa: Restored columnType visibility.
- b4b76d6: Minor refactoring of ERDContent
Stay tuned for more exciting updates coming soon! πβ¨